The All Terrain Pack 24L is rated to IPX7, features a robust, Delrin tooth, waterproof main zipper to access the main compartment and to keep your load out dry. An additional external zippered pocket keeps those smaller items quick and easy to access. Constructed of 1000D RPET (eco-friendly recycled polyester fibers) with fully welded seams. Rain or shine, land or sea, this pack is truly all terrain and ideally suited for amphibious adventures, overlanding in any weather, rainy day hikes or rides, life in the PNW, packrafting, fly fishing, scuba, canyoneering to island hopping and more. Available in Universal Field Gray. #atpack
This day pack is designed for any weather and dialed toward those who life life in and around water. The 24L capacity holds a good day's load out for most users with an external and internal zippered pockets for extra organization, and a thermomolded padded back for all day comfort. A daisy chain, 3 delta-ring clip points, 4 accessory cinch straps for rod tubes or take down paddles, removable padded waist belt and loop panels for morale patches, round out some of the extra details. One of the unique design features of the AT Pack 24L is the built in inflator nozzle. The spring-loaded valve makes using it an easy operation to deflate or inflate the pack. The inflator nozzle allows the pack to be inflated for buoyancy and used as a field expedient, temporary floatation device if needed. The AT Pack 24L is amphibious rated, versatile, capable, and designed for all terrain adventures on and off the grid.
